| Summary: | Pleomorphic adenoma is the most frequent benign tumor arising in the major salivary glands.Histopathological findings of this tumor vary; however, extensive necrosis does not generally occur. We describe a 74-year-old woman with pleomorphic adenoma of the submandibular gland associated with extensive degenerative necrosis. She consulted our hospital because of a painless swelling that had persisted for 20 years in the right submandibular region. MRI revealed a mass with a distinct border in the right submandibular gland, associated with a low-signal-intensity area. The patient was given a diagnosis of pleomorphic adenoma of the right submandibular gland, and tumorectomy was performed under general anesthesia. Histopathological examination of the resected specimen showed a pleomorphic adenoma with extensive necrosis. During the 5-year postoperative follow-up, there has been no recurrence. Pleomorphic adenoma of the major salivary glands with extensive degenerative necrosis is very rare. Only 9 cases of this type of adenoma in the parotid gland have been reported. To our knowledge, this is the first such tumor arising in the submandibular gland to be reported. |
